Striker named as dangerman

Birmingham City, 11:50, March 10, 2010

Alex McLeish pinpointed striker Chucho Benitez's return to form as the key factor in Blues' 2-1 win at Portsmouth last night.

The Ecuadorian hitman, starting his first match in four weeks, fed strike partner Cameron Jerome for both his first-half goals and terrorised the Pompey defence which had looked so untroubled on Saturday in the Cup.
McLeish said: "I thought Chucho had lost a bit of confidence in the last few weeks. He had an injury and perhaps wasn't feeling quite his best.
"The players were finding it difficult to find him on the pitch and he wasn't getting into any of the little pockets he had been looking dangerous in during the early part of the season.
"He came on last Saturday and I think he got a wee lift from his performance. He created a bit and he looked very dangerous tonight."
